Wings vs. Mystics Prediction, Preview

On the season, these teams have split their two matchups. Dallas won the first game in convincing fashion, defeating Washington 92-69 on May 18th. Of course, they were led by All-Star Paige Bueckers, who put up 18 points and seven assists. Jessica Shepard, Dallas’ breakout star, also made her presence felt with 12 points, 16 rebounds, and six assists. Washington’s stars were not able to equal them; Sonia Citron and Kiki Iriafen combined for only 16 points on 5-of-12 shooting.

In their second matchup last week, Washington got their get-back. This time, the stars showed up, and Shakira Austin went crazy with 28 points and 10 rebounds. Iriafen bounced back as well with 22 points and nine boards. Though Citron’s shot let her down, she got to the line a ton, finishing with 16 points, five rebounds, and five assists. Though Bueckers went off again, Washington managed to contain Shepard, which was the key to getting the win this time around.

So much rests on the frontcourt. Shepard has been a massive presence for Dallas as a scorer, rebounder, and playmaker, but not so much as a defender. It’s no surprise that Austin and Iriafen combined for 50 points in that last matchup, especially with Awak Kuier’s early exit from the game. Kuier has been an extremely important defender for Dallas this year, and her absence left Shepard on an island. Both teams will bring a clean injury report to this one, and the Wings will be hoping Kuier’s presence will keep Austin and Iriafen in check.

The other important duel is in the backcourt. Sonia Citron gets plenty of plaudits for her offense, as she should, but her defense has been exceptional. Citron will have her hands full trying to contain MVP candidate Paige Bueckers. Conversely, rookie Azzi Fudd will spend a lot of time guarding Citron and has done well so far in their matchups. Arike Ogunbowale is a wild card as always; her scoring efficiency can sink or swim the Wings on any given night.

Michaela Onyenwere is a huge X-factor here as well. If she can knock down threes for the Mystics and draw the defense out, it makes it even harder for Dallas to contend with Iriafen and Austin. But if the shots aren’t falling, it simplifies the defensive gameplan for the Wings, and makes life hard on Washington’s struggling offense.
